BY THE NUMBERS
The state Constitution gives governors the power to reduce and commute sentences, and to pardon prisoners. No one on death row has received clemency since 1967. Here are recent pardons:
Arnold Schwarzenegger, 2003-present
3
--
Gray Davis, 1999-2003
0
--
Pete Wilson, 1991-1999
13
--
George Deukmejian, 1983-1991
328
--
Jerry Brown, 1975-1983
403
--
Ronald Reagan, 1967-1975
575
